User comments on (830) 321-4499 suggest it may be linked to a potential scam, with multiple reports claiming it pretends to be associated with a well-known insurance provider. Commenters noted persistent calls and texts requesting sensitive information like vehicle photos and identifying details, raising concerns about legitimacy. Users advise caution due to inconsistencies with official contact numbers.

They claimed to be USAA wanting pictures of the vehicle damage. The text was informal and didn't identify an individual or adjuster. I had already sent USAA numerous pictures, so suspected it was a scam. The phone number also didn't match any of USAA's contact numbers.

Claims to be with USAA insurance. They are NOT. They want photos of my vehicle that was involved in an accident including photos of the license plate and VIN number.
